I am looking at buying a 2004 yamaha warrior and the owner says it won't idle. Supposely he installed a carb kit but no change. Anyone seen any common problems. Carb, timing, or ? He says it runs good other than the idling problem.

check to make sure the idle screw is the right one, meaning that it touches the throttle slider. i bought one and someone put the wrong screw in and it was too short and the engine wouldn't idle, i welded a small piece of rod onto the end to lenghten it and it idles now and i can adjust it like it's suppose to. never know what someone will do that has no idea how to work on these things and mess it all up with just a simple little screw that the wrong one.
